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ance.

Phenom X4 9150e has a 64.3% higher aggregate performance score, and 100% more physical cores and 100% more threads.

Celeron B830, on the other hand, has a 103.1% more advanced lithography process, and 85.7% lower power consumption.

The Phenom X4 9150e is our recommended choice as it beats the Celeron B830 in performance tests.

Note that Phenom X4 9150e is a desktop processor while Celeron B830 is a notebook one.
